BMW E30 M3 Restomod: 250HP M54 Swap Takes on the Nürburgring Drag & Track by turboandstance - September 18, 2026 This BMW E30 M3 restomod combines classic E30 styling with modern performance upgrades and a 250hp M54 engine swap. The widebody build weighs approximately 1150kg and features BMW M4 brakes front and rear, ABS integrated beneath the dashboard, BC Racing coilovers and NS-2R tires. With its lightweight chassis, upgraded braking system and carefully integrated modifications, the E30 is built to deliver an engaging driving experience on the Nürburgring. Behind the wheel, the car impresses with its lightweight feel, powerful and controllable brakes and playful chassis balance. The main criticism is the throttle response and rev hang, which makes heel-and-toe downshifts difficult due to the engine continuing to rev after the throttle is released. Despite this issue, the E30 M3 restomod is described as remarkably complete, with air conditioning, strong brakes and a highly controllable chassis.
